Understanding the Role of Outdoor Security Lighting
Outdoor security lighting serves multiple purposes. It illuminates dark areas, enhances visibility for surveillance cameras, and creates a sense of safety for residents and visitors. Properly designed lighting can significantly reduce crime rates in residential and commercial areas.
Deterrence and Visibility
One of the primary functions of outdoor security lighting is to deter criminal activity. Well-lit areas are less appealing to intruders, as they increase the likelihood of detection. Additionally, enhanced visibility aids in the identification of individuals, vehicles, and potential threats, contributing to overall safety. Strategically placed lights, such as motion sensors and floodlights, can create a dynamic security environment that not only illuminates pathways but also draws attention to any unusual movements, further discouraging potential wrongdoers.

Key Considerations in Lighting Design
When designing outdoor security lighting systems, several factors must be considered to ensure effectiveness and efficiency. These considerations include the type of lighting, placement, and integration with existing security systems. Properly executed lighting design not only enhances safety but also contributes to the overall aesthetic of the property, making it both secure and visually appealing.
Types of Lighting
Different types of lighting fixtures serve various purposes in outdoor security lighting. Floodlights, wall-mounted lights, and motion-activated lights are commonly used. Floodlights provide broad illumination, making them ideal for large areas, while wall-mounted lights can enhance visibility around entry points. Motion-activated lights are particularly effective in deterring intruders, as they illuminate only when movement is detected. Additionally, solar-powered lights offer an eco-friendly alternative, utilizing renewable energy to provide illumination without incurring high electricity costs. These fixtures can be strategically placed in remote areas where wiring may be impractical, ensuring that even the most secluded spots are monitored.
Placement and Coverage
Strategic placement of lighting fixtures is essential for maximizing coverage and minimizing shadows. Key areas to focus on include entry points, driveways, pathways, and dark corners. A well-thought-out layout ensures that all critical areas are illuminated, reducing the risk of blind spots where intruders could hide. Furthermore, the height and angle of the lights should be carefully considered; fixtures mounted too low may create unwanted shadows, while those positioned too high might not provide adequate illumination for ground-level activities. Incorporating adjustable fixtures can also enhance flexibility, allowing for modifications based on seasonal changes or landscaping adjustments. Additionally, the use of smart lighting technology can provide real-time monitoring and control, enabling property owners to adjust lighting settings remotely, ensuring optimal security at all times.

Smart Lighting Systems
Smart lighting systems allow users to control their outdoor lights remotely, providing flexibility and convenience. These systems can be programmed to turn on and off at specific times or respond to motion. Integration with home automation systems further enhances security, as users can simulate occupancy by controlling lights while away. Many smart lighting solutions also offer features such as geofencing, which can automatically activate lights when a user approaches their home, creating a welcoming atmosphere while ensuring safety. Furthermore, some systems can send alerts to homeowners if unusual activity is detected, allowing for prompt action.
Energy Efficiency
Modern outdoor security lights often utilize LED technology, which is energy-efficient and long-lasting. LEDs consume significantly less energy than traditional incandescent bulbs, reducing electricity costs and minimizing environmental impact. Additionally, many LED fixtures are designed to withstand harsh weather conditions, ensuring durability and reliability. The longevity of LED lights means less frequent replacements, which not only saves money but also reduces waste. Moreover, advancements in solar-powered LED lights have made it possible to harness renewable energy for outdoor security, allowing homeowners to install lighting in remote areas without the need for electrical wiring. This not only enhances security but also promotes sustainability, aligning with the growing trend of eco-conscious living.
Implementing Outdoor Security Lighting
Successful implementation of outdoor security lighting requires careful planning and execution. This process involves assessing the specific needs of the area, selecting appropriate fixtures, and ensuring compliance with local regulations.
Site Assessment
A thorough site assessment is the foundation of an effective lighting strategy. This assessment should consider the layout of the property, existing landscaping, and potential vulnerabilities. Engaging with security professionals can provide valuable insights into the most effective lighting solutions for the specific environment.
Compliance and Regulations
Before installation, it is essential to familiarize oneself with local regulations regarding outdoor lighting. Some areas have restrictions on light pollution, which can affect the design and placement of fixtures. Ensuring compliance not only avoids potential fines but also contributes to a more sustainable and community-friendly lighting solution.
Maintenance and Longevity of Lighting Systems
Once outdoor security lighting systems are installed, ongoing maintenance is crucial to ensure their effectiveness. Regular inspections and maintenance can prolong the lifespan of fixtures and maintain optimal performance.
Regular Inspections
Routine inspections should be conducted to check for any damaged or malfunctioning lights. Burned-out bulbs, corroded fixtures, and misaligned lights can significantly reduce the effectiveness of the lighting system. Addressing these issues promptly can prevent potential security risks.
